We have a long history of producing self-adhesive lines. Since the
beginning of our factory, we have started to develop and produce
self-adhesive lines. Because of our strong R & D strength, our
products have a wide range of applications.We have a full range of
self-adhesive lines and a wide range of applications.Thermal class
is155C, 180 C, 200 C, 220 C. Conductor material includes enameled
round wire, enameled copper-clad aluminum wire
APPLICATION
Speaker coil, such as microphone, earphone, speaker, hearing
aid,Bluetooth audio, speakers, etc.;High-temperature voice coils,
such as car audio, home theater, high-power speakers, etc.
High-sensitivity voice coils, such as headphone speakers and
high-temperature-resistant voice coils;micro vibration motor,such
as focus-driving,(coin-type, coreless-type) and other electrical
and electronics components, such as inductor, watch coil, coin
machine coil, buzzer;magnetic head, IC card.
TEST REPORT
2-SFK5W 0.120mm
Characteristics | Technical requests | Test Results |
Min. | Ave. | Max. |
Conductor Diameter | 0.120± | 0.002 | 0.12 | 0.12 | 0.12 |
0.002 |
(Basecoat dimensions) Overall dimensions | Max. 0.146 mm | 0.144 | 0.144 | 0.145 |
Insulation Film Thickness | Min. 0.011 mm | 0.013 | 0.013 | 0.013 |
Bonding Film Thickness | Min. 0.010 mm | 0.011 | 0.011 | 0.012 |
Continulty of covering | Max.60 pcs | Max. 0 |
Flexibility | / | / |
Adherence | no crack | Good |
Breakdown Voltage | Min.3000 V | Min. 4865 |
Resistance to Softening(Cut through) | Continue 2 times pass | 200℃/Good |
Solder test(390±5℃) | Max.2s | Max.1.5s |
Bonding Strength | Min.20g | 35g |
Electrical Resistance(20℃) | Max.1550Ω/km | 1508 | 1508 | 1509 |
Elongation | Min.26% | 29% | 30% | 30% |
Breaking Load | Min. | / | / | / |
Surface appearance | Smooth | Good |
Test Result | OK | Conclusion | Approved |
